Transaction 5445018749a5c63eac91dbdd0090919d3673a30671483f5b76685c83a9e2478a

1 Input
2 Outputs
  • 5445018749a5c63eac91dbdd0090919d3673a30671483f5b76685c83a9e2478a:0
  • value  24087
    address  37w9XVoz1C9gai53tu8hfuQ8DhhcaGKr3T
  • 5445018749a5c63eac91dbdd0090919d3673a30671483f5b76685c83a9e2478a:1
  • value  312817
    address  1LouU2DmVaYKpRgWtUyDL8AHwEZKEQEzv1